How much pain is normal after a lung biopsy? i had a biopsy more than a week ago, and im still having pain. is this normal?

A doctor has provided 1 answer
Dr. Loki Skylizard answered

Specializes in Thoracic Surgery

Variable: Generally, yes. The recovery greatly depends on the technique/s used. Vats? Thorocotomy? What is your body shape, i.e. How much space between your ribs? Often, deep breathing spirometer and stretching exercise under surgeon guidance helps. Your thoracic surgeon would be better able to discuss reasonable recovery expectations and what sort of activities may help or should be avoided.
